Grooving Tools vs. End Mills: What's the Difference?
Choosing the right cutter for a specific job can be difficult, especially when evaluating grooving tools and end mills. While both eliminate material, they function with fundamentally unique designs and are intended for different applications. End mills, with their numerous cutting rims , are typically used for general-purpose milling, slotting, and profiling – effectively, creating intricate shapes. They can carry out shallow grooves, but aren’t best for significant ones. Grooving tools, conversely, are dedicated machines specifically designed for cutting petite and extensive grooves. They possess a single cutting edge – often geared for maximum material displacement in a restricted space .
Here's a short comparison:
- End Mills: Suitable for general milling, profiling, and slotting. Can cut shallow grooves. Give increased feed rates.
- Grooving Tools: Designed for cutting substantial and narrow grooves. Generate a smoother groove surface .

Optimal Practices for Employing 1 End Mill Bits
To gain optimal results and extend the duration of your 1 face mill bits, implement several crucial practices. Firstly , ensure correct securing and centering – vibration can rapidly degrade the milling edge. Also, use the correct feed and depth cut based on the stock being cut. Consistently check the tool for wear and discard it when necessary; worn tools can lead to substandard surface quality and increased risk of breakage . Finally, employ appropriate coolant to lessen heat and here enhance bit duration.
